Given Input numbers are 884, 157, 100, 712
To find the GCD of numbers using factoring list out all the divisors of each number
Divisors of 884
List of positive integer divisors of 884 that divides 884 without a remainder.
1, 2, 4, 13, 17, 26, 34, 52, 68, 221, 442, 884
Divisors of 157
List of positive integer divisors of 157 that divides 157 without a remainder.
1, 157
Divisors of 100
List of positive integer divisors of 100 that divides 100 without a remainder.
1, 2, 4, 5, 10, 20, 25, 50, 100
Divisors of 712
List of positive integer divisors of 712 that divides 712 without a remainder.
1, 2, 4, 8, 89, 178, 356, 712
Greatest Common Divisior
We found the divisors of 884, 157, 100, 712 . The biggest common divisior number is the GCD number.
So the Greatest Common Divisior 884, 157, 100, 712 is 1.
Therefore, GCD of numbers 884, 157, 100, 712 is 1
Given Input Data is 884, 157, 100, 712
Make a list of Prime Factors of all the given numbers initially
Prime Factorization of 884 is 2 x 2 x 13 x 17
Prime Factorization of 157 is 157
Prime Factorization of 100 is 2 x 2 x 5 x 5
Prime Factorization of 712 is 2 x 2 x 2 x 89
The above numbers do not have any common prime factor. So GCD is 1
